Re: MAC PRO card question for MAC employees!
When they ask for your name - we usually pick the first name that matches you which may not be your Pro Dicount profile especially if you dont tell me you are a pro member. There may be two different profiles, as in one that you had before you got your pro card and and one after. They do not merge into one. Heck there might be six or seven profiles with your info (ie if your name is Michelle Thompson - there may be ones with different spellings of Michelle and Thompson). So we started asking for id to cut down on adding additional erroneous/misspelled names but we can't delete the other older incorrect ones.
So unless you tell me you are a pro member, i won't know and won't be looking for it - which is why we ask for you to give us the card first so I won't have to re- ring everything and put it under the correct name.

Re: Mac Pro Membership?
From the MAC Pro UK application form:
PROFESSIONAL IDENTIFICATION
Two pieces of professional criteria must be included with the application and membership fee.
Examples of professional identification:
Composite Card
Business Card with name and specific profession
Editorial Page with name credit
Union Card
Head Shot & CV
Professional License
Diploma/Certificate
Publication Masthead
Programme/Press Materials w/name
Contract on production company letterhead
Crew/Call list on prod. co. letterhead
Professional letter of reference of employment
Required identification must be current, indicate your name and specific profession.
All identification will be destroyed after processing and will not be returned to you.
Basically you need to have proof that you work in the industry.

Re: Mac Pro Membership?
Originally Posted by couturesista
What's a composite card, is it the same as a business card?
a composite card is more of a model or actor thing. It's a double sided "ad" printed on card with some photos and stats (like measurements, height, weight, hair colour, shoe size etc).
It's used by the model and her agency as a kind of calling card, and can be giving to a potential client to review. In a sense, it's like a business card for an actor or a model.
